摘要 <P>PROBLEM TO BE SOLVED: To provide a means by which, a remaining EGR gas in an exhaust path is rapidly discharged in acceleration to permit an engine or a vehicle to be improved in acceleration performance. Ž<P>SOLUTION: An engine DE is equipped with an exhaust turbosupercharger 19 and an electrically-operated supercharger 21. Besides, the engine DE is equipped with a low-pressure EGR path 42 which couples an upstream common intake path 16 of a compressor 19a in the exhaust turbosupercharger 19 and a downstream common exhaust path 26 of a turbine 19b in the same 19 to allow part of an exhaust gas to be refluxed to an intake system and further is equipped with a low-pressure EGR device 41 including a low-pressure EGR valve 44 arranged in the low-pressure EGR path 42. A control unit C allows the electric supercharger 21 to be operated when gathering speed. Here, when an engine operational status is in an EGR region, an operational revolution speed of the electric supercharger 21 is made higher than in a non EGR region to promote air scavenging at the time of gathering speed, enhancing acceleration performance.
